1. #SHOOTING: Nine people have been killed following a fatal shooting in the Czech Republic town of Uhersky Brod.

2. #AIRLINE: Transport Minister Paschal Donohoe has rejected the current bid from IAG for Aer Lingus.  

3. #CRASH: At least thirty people have been injured and one person arrested after a commuter train in California crashed into a truck.

4. #CLONMEL: The Supreme Court has dismissed an appeal alleging a teenage Traveller was discriminated against when he was refused admission to a local school.

5. #PLEASE: TD Mick Wallace asked a judge for his “rope ladder back” today. He’s representing himself in a case arising from the Shannon Airport protest he staged with Clare Daly last year.
